*jffs2 [#m61aebd2]
FLASH を jffs2 でフォーマットして使ってみる。
組み込み機器とかじゃないなら普通に FAT32 とか使ってた方が便利だけど・・・
良く読み書きしまくる場合とか・・・
ちなみにマウントが非常に時間かかります。


以下、サンプル手順
以下のように sdb2 を jffs2 として設定する例を示す。
 /dev/sdb1 <-- Windows FAT32
 /dev/sdb2 <-- jffs2
-必要なモジュール、ツールの設定
 modprobe jffs2
 modprobe mtdblock
 aptitude install  mtd-tools
-flash のデバイスを確認する
 ls -l /dev/disk/by-id
-確認したデバイスのパーティションを fdisk で切る。
[[OS/Linux/fdisk]] を参照してパーティションを設定する。
-mtdブロック化
 modprobe block2mtd block2mtd=/dev/sdb2
 
 (解除する場合は以下)
 modprobe -r block2mtd
-確認
 cat /proc/mtd
-領域初期化
 flash_eraseall -j /dev/mtd0
-マウント
 mount -t jffs2 /dev/mtdblock0 /export/disk2
 サイズでかいとメッチャ時間かかります。(2Gで3分とか?)

トップ   差分 バックアップ リロード   一覧 検索 最終更新   ヘルプ   最終更新のRSS